What's up guys? Anyone ever mess around with the inner fender lip in the rear of the LS? I just got 255's on 18's and I'm having a little trouble with rubbing on that one little flare in the wheel well. If so, what did you use to fix it?
 
In the Buick world we use a wood baseball bat...You put it in between the tire and wheelwell and have someone drive the car forward and back until the lip gets rolled.
 
Even once you get past the lip there is another little step out you might have to tend to inside the fender. This is were the 20's rubbed (once).
 
I'm thinking about tapping it with a rubber mallet. It doesn't rub with just me in the car.
 
trust me you want something that wil roll the lip not beat it in...You will NEVER get it straight if you start hitting it, it will never look right.
 
It's not the actual fender, it's more of a little lip type thing inside the wheel well. I'll take it to a shop and see what they say.
 
i took a ball and put it up there and rolled it back and forth. DONT HIT IT WITH ANYTHING. i did taht with a rubber mallet and u can se ewhere i did it and it chipped the paint. roll it and be catrful
